    Here she is, my Tailor Made 812 GTS in Pure Metal Silver. The interior rendering shows the door grab handle in aluminum, but it's in carbon. I think we just missed doing that in the photoshop rendering. Main features of the car:

    Exterior
    - Dark red racing stripe going narrow from the front bumper extending all the way (wide) into the rear deckled
    - Painted shield
    - Painted black brake caliper
    - Forged diamond cut finish on wheels
    - All exterior pieces in carbon fiber

    Interior
    - Heritage leather in red
    - Special shiny silver leather piping and shiny silver stitching on Cavallino
    - Classic vertical stripe seat center
    - Tone on tone stitching
    - Lower center tunnel and lower footwell area in diamond stitching
    - All interior pieces in carbon except door panel because we want to showcase the heritage leather

    A couple of things that we considered but eventually scrapped:

    - Colored carbon in red, which is a nice bordeaux finish, but nicked it because we feel it's too much and provide too much red on the inside
    - Color stripes on the steering wheel and transmission buttons (getting sporty, away from the classy theme we want to maintain)
    - Contrasting stitching (eg. black leather with bordeaux stitching, heritage leather with black stitching)
    - Stripe in Grigio Coburn, to make the exterior less pop and have the interior with the red leather as the main "pop" (I thought hard about this, but eventually went with the dark red stripe, but I feel either way would work well)
